Lot 537
Gem Multiple $1 FRN Major Error Note. This is an R-8 category error that is rarely offered at auction. What you are bidding on is a Type II Inverted Overprint with a portion of the top showing on the portrait side and the Green Third Overprint featured on the reverse upside down. This is a $1 1999 FRN s/n A03637965B graded PMG 65 EPQ Gem Uncirculated, and it is a terrific rarity. Estimated Value $3,000 - 5,000
The vast majority of overprints that appear on the back of notes are "right side up". This beauty features the overprint in upside down position. The fourth edition of the Bart guidebook places the value at $2750, but that valuation was eight years ago and we feel today's price will advance significantly.
As with so many notes in the Black Horse Collection, you can't call your favorite dealer up and ask him (or her) to ship you a note like this. They just don't sit in inventory, when or if they ever become available.
